Yale University’s Political Science Department offers a variety of internship opportunities that allow students to explore their interests in politics, governance, and public service while gaining valuable hands-on experience. These internships are tailored to provide students with exposure to the complexities of political systems, policymaking, and international relations.
One of the primary benefits of Yale’s political science internships is the diverse range of opportunities available. Students can work with government agencies, non-governmental organizations (NGOs), think tanks, political campaigns, and international institutions. These internships often involve tasks like conducting policy research, analyzing data, drafting reports, and assisting in advocacy efforts.

For students with an interest in international politics, Yale also facilitates internships with global organizations and foreign government offices, offering a broader perspective on global governance and diplomacy.
Yale’s political science internships are supported by robust faculty mentorship and departmental resources. Professors and advisors play an active role in helping students identify internship opportunities that align with their interests and career goals. The department also connects students with alumni networks, many of whom hold influential positions in politics, law, and international affairs. These connections open doors to prestigious internships that can be pivotal for students aspiring to work in government, academia, or the private sector.
Additionally, many internships offered through Yale are funded or provide stipends, ensuring accessibility for students from diverse financial backgrounds. Yale’s Summer Experience Award (SEA), for example, helps fund internships for undergraduates, allowing them to focus on their learning and contributions without the burden of financial constraints. This inclusivity ensures that all students, regardless of their economic circumstances, have an equal opportunity to benefit from these enriching experiences.
For students seeking to make the most of their internships, Yale’s Office of Career Strategy provides support in preparing resumes, practicing interviews, and developing professional networking skills. Workshops, information sessions, and panels featuring professionals in political science fields further enhance students’ readiness to excel in their roles. These resources ensure that students are not only prepared to secure internships but also equipped to thrive in them.
